Thank you for visiting my Uganda Trip Blog!
I travelled to Uganda, Africa from Feb. 18-27 with my friend Lisa Erickson and a medical team from Janesville, WI, to support the work of Hope Institute of Uganda.
Lisa and I brought spiritual encouragement and support in the form of teaching and prayer at the Jinja Light and Life Church, while the medical team performed surgeries at Buluba hospital.

Kim Shared a Blessing with the bead makers in Jinja, Uganda on Feb. 24

We are made in God’s image and likeness.
When I see your creations I am reminded of the creativity of our God 
who made so many things from nothing.
When you take scraps and transform them into something beautiful, 
I think of God who takes the scraps (junk) of our lives 
and transforms them into something beautiful and useful.
When I see you take the time to carefully craft each bead one by one, 
then take more time to glaze, and glaze again,
and more time to string, and more time to craft designs;
 I think of God’s great love and patience with us 
and his willingness to forgive us over and over.
When you string the beads together into one whole piece, 
I remember God who takes each one of us and puts us together to make us the church; 
one body with Jesus as the head, held together by the Father who created all things.  
Together we are strong and beautiful.
When we take your jewelry and share it with others, 
we have opportunity to tell about the love and care of God in your life and ours. 
We are so blessed to be a part of this process.
